Output 2e6edfa6068d3a5da21fcb60a7f73b7d7f07e70d4c104bf86b9255e1302cfdfd:0

value
1308641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a80d1bb8275ed6d6e603a0408f7e7ac82c11c7aa OP_EQUAL
address
3H1b9YsvQARKrsE2GjgWWnXxbp2Fu3wZ4D
transaction
2e6edfa6068d3a5da21fcb60a7f73b7d7f07e70d4c104bf86b9255e1302cfdfd
confirmations
209811
spent
true